[OSM-ja] highwayオブジェクトへのadmin_levelタグ
Satoshi IIDA
nyampire @ gmail.com
2014年 6月 4日 (水) 22:40:18 UTC
いいだです。
yasuさん、ありがとうございます。
個人的には、ご提案の通り、リレーションとして networkタグを使うのが一番すっきりします。
* 国道routeリレーション
network=ja:national
ref = ***
* 都道府県道routeリレーション
network=ja:prefectural
ref = *
として、admin_levelタグを削除、という方向で、利用例を整理して、
再度このMLで提案してみたいとおもいます。
また、Twitterで少し話題になっていたのですが、
国道・県道だから、ということでリレーション側にhighway=*** を割り振ってしまうと、
例えば海上国道(route=ferry)や、階段国道 (highway=steps)のときに
レンダリングがおかしくなる、という問題がでるようです。
(海上に、緑色のTrunkの線が引かれてしまう)
http://ja.wikipedia.org/wiki/%E6%B5%B7%E4%B8%8A%E5%9B%BD%E9%81%93
http://ja.wikipedia.org/wiki/%E5%9B%BD%E9%81%93339%E5%8F%B7
こちらも、リレーションとしてnetworkタグがあれば
highwayタグは不要なのではないか、と思っています。
レンダリングに引っ張られるのはよくないという意見もあると思いますが、
そもそも type=route, route=roadのリレーションに与えるタグに highwayタグの指定は無く、
いままで付与していたのが間違いだったのではないか、という意見です。
bus routeに対してhighwayタグを与えないのと一緒です。
個人的には、国道や県道の重複区間に対応するためにも、
最終的に国道・県道の表現はリレーションにするのが好ましいと思っていることもあり、
ちょっと範囲の広い問題ではありますが、整理をかけたいなぁ、と思う次第です。
2014年6月3日 0:13 kondoh yasunori <yasu.kondoh @ gmail.com>:
> yasu(yasu747)です。
>
> 国道・県道のタグ付けですが、
> リレーションとして
> http://wiki.openstreetmap.org/wiki/JA:Relation:route
> network=ja:national
> network=ja:prefectural
> というのがすでにあったと思いますので、現地調査レベルではこれで十分ではな
> いでしょうか。trunk/primary/secondary = 国道/主要地方道/都道府県道 でカ
> バーしきれない場合はリレーションをつける。あるいは管理者を記述したい場合
> はリレーションをつける。くらいで。
>
>
> > 三浦です。
> >
> > On 2014年05月30日 12:58, Satoshi IIDA wrote:
> > >
> > > いいだです。
> > >
> > > レンダラーの話は全くしていないです。
> > > あくまで、DBに情報として正しく入れるにはどうしたらよいだろう、という話題です。
> >
> > いや、リファレンスにされていた、昔の議論について、指摘したところです。
> > 飯田さんの提案ではなくて。
> > しかしながら、mapnikのスタイルでは、Wikiの記録やMLの記録にあるような
> > 指定は有りませんから、その当時、なぜそのような議論になったのか、
> > よくわかりませんね。
> >
> > >
> > > 例えば、amenity=hospitalのノードに対して、
> > > 樹木の種を表現するspeciesタグが一緒に使われていたら、それは「間違い」だと感じます。
> > > それと同じで、highway=*のウェイに対して、
> > > 行政区境のレベルを表現するadmin_levelタグを使うのはおかしいのではないか?ということです。
> > >
> > > > 現行の分類では、分類しきれない情報をどのようにDBに入れるか
> > > はい、そうです。
> > > admin_levelタグ以外で「国道・県道」をあらわすにはどのタグを使うのが良いだろうか、ということです。
> > > だいたい以下の3つのどれかかな、とは思っています。
> > >
> > > 1. 既存のタグでよさげなものを探す
> > > 2. 新しくタグを考えて、切り替える
> > > 3. 国道や県道、という情報はオブジェクトに対するrefタグで表現できるので、そもそもadmin_levelタグの付与が不要
> > >
> > >
> >
> > Operator と、所有責任者をわけたタグを提案する、という事が、直感的でしょうか。
> >
> >
> > 三浦
> >
> >
>
> --
> kondoh yasunori <yasu.kondoh @ gmail.com>
>
>
> _______________________________________________
> Talk-ja mailing list
> Talk-ja @ openstreetmap.org
> https://lists.openstreetmap.org/listinfo/talk-ja
>
--
Satoshi IIDA
mail: nyampire @ gmail.com
twitter: @nyampire
-------------- next part --------------
HTML$B$NE:IU%U%!%$%k$rJ]4I$7$^$7$?(B...
URL: <http://lists.openstreetmap.org/pipermail/talk-ja/attachments/20140605/3c5aaad6/attachment.html>
Talk-ja メーリングリストの案内